Three weeks - three new emulator updates for AmigaOS 4

In the past three weeks I worked extensively on updating the emulators for AmigaOS 4 that I started porting some years ago.

First was Hatari - the Atari ST/TT/STE/Falcon emulator. I first ported it back in 2005 and it evolved quite well since then. Currently it works very good on microAmigaOne:


Then I updated Atari++ - the excellent Atari 8 bits emulator for the Atari machines 130XL, 400, 400XL, 800, 800XL and 5200. This emulator is a later project, but it's very accurate and has lots of configuration options:




Finally I updated XRoar - the Dragon 32/64 and Tandy Coco/Coco 2 emulator, which also got better during the years and now it's very compatible and offers resizeable display thanks by the use of OpenGL textures:




Meanwhile I also worked on some 8 bit assembler projects and I am slowly returning to coding on the Amiga and the other cool platforms of the past.

CP/M on Apple II

CP/M Operating System on Apple II
Yesterday I started wielding with the CP/M Operating System on the Apple II. CP/M runs on Apple II machines with the use of Z80 SoftCard by Microsoft. 6502 and Z80 processor in single machine, makes a powerful retro computer. The Apple II specific software is still better though, even if slower.

Retro computing meeting

Last week I attended a meeting of people interested in retro machines and computers. I had the chance to see one of the last machines produced in the Pravetz factory and saw in live the Pravetz 8S machine which was produced in early 1990-ies and had almost all the chips inside cloned from the Apple II.
Other rare item was the Oric 3 inch disk drive and vintage Elka calculators.
More than 5 hours chat with people taught me many aspects of the hardware and software hacking on the machines of the early 1980-ies.
